the thing that gives the 5.0 the biggest edge is the push-rod style engine as to compared with the 4.6 modular. i had a 2000 mustang gt, it hauled *** compared to my civic, majorly. 5.0s are much slower stock on stock to the modular 4.6's but the 5.0s are one of the easiest modded engines in exsistance. major horsepower for not much money.
